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
140 70347 243042339
23 8616
23 8616
892376 6107910 446
All about undefined
Interested in learning more?
23 8616
892376 6107910 446
See more
69461069780 5456 58100144505
228 3707 835349291 388955
See more
43447882019 178251 9806
50290316692 80751105906 809 05
See more